Ingredients

  • 12 slices white bread
  • 12 oz. sharp process cheese
  • 1 1/2 lb. fresh asparagus, trimmed
  • 2 c. cooked ham, diced
  • 6 eggs
  • 2 Tbsp. onion, minced
  • 1/2 tsp. salt
  • 1/4 tsp. dry mustard
  • 3 c. milk

Method

  • Using a doughnut cutter, cut 12 circles and holes from bread; set aside.
  • Tear remaining bread in pieces and place in a greased 13 x 9-inch baking pan.
  • Layer cheese, asparagus and ham over torn bread; arrange bread circles and holes in top.
  • Lightly beat eggs with milk.
  • Add onion, salt and mustard; mix well. Pour egg mixture over bread circles and holes.
  • Cover and refrigerate at least 6 hours or overnight.
  • Bake, uncovered, at 325° for 55 minutes or until top is light golden brown.
  • Let stand 10 minutes before serving.
  • Yields 6 to 8 servings.
